Geophysical Data Processing Manager
Petrobras
Max Velasques holds a Bachelor’s degree in Physics from the Federal University of Rio de Janeiro (UFRJ) and a Master’s degree in Geophysics from the Colorado School of Mines. He has been working at Petrobras since 2006, where he built a solid career as a geophysicist. Max began his professional career in Seismic Data Acquisition, participating in several onshore seismic surveys across different Brazilian basins. He later transitioned to Seismic Data Processing, playing an important role in major exploration projects. Between 2010 and 2018, he served as coordinator of seismic processing projects for the pre-salt province in the Santos Basin, one of Petrobras’ most strategic exploration areas. Since 2020, Max has been leading the Geophysical Data Processing Management at Petrobras, with overall responsibility for the company’s seismic processing activities. His current role involves overseeing a large portfolio of complex processing projects focused on new exploratory frontiers as well as on the monitoring of post-salt and pre-salt producing fields—areas that represent major technical and strategic challenges for the company.

Petrobras
Carlos Cunha was born in 1957 in the city of Rio de Janeiro and graduated with a bachelor's degree in Physics from UFRJ in 1979. He joined Petrobras in 1982, where he remains to this day. He obtained his PhD in Geophysics from Stanford University (USA) in 1992, under the supervision of Prof. Jon Claerbout, with a dissertation on VTI elastic migration. In 2007, he received the Décio Oddone Award from SBGf (outstanding achievement in geophysics in the oil category). Since 2013, he has served as a Master Consultant in geophysics, working in the areas of imaging, attributes, and seismic data inversion.
